There is no set amount of money that you must have in order to play Texas Holdem at a casino. However, it is generally recommended that you have at least $100 on hand.
PRO TIP:When playing Texas Holdem at a casino, it is important to make sure you have enough money on hand to cover the buy-in for the game. The buy-ins can range from $100 to thousands of dollars depending on the stakes of the game. Make sure you have enough money before sitting down at the table.
This will allow you to make decent sized bets and still have enough money left over in case you lose a few hands.
Of course, the amount of money that you ultimately need to play Texas Holdem at a casino depends on the stakes that you are playing for. If you are only playing for small stakes, then you will not need nearly as much money as someone who is playing for high stakes.
In conclusion, the amount of money that you need to play Texas Holdem at a casino depends on the stakes that you are playing for.
However, it is generally recommended that you have at least $100 on hand in order to make decent sized bets and still have enough money left over in case you lose a few hands.
